Output 1bad6d393cbe45b462dc51f00223e69734218ebd275a7e86fcc0c7cc795b5bfa:1

value
570898
script pubkey
OP_0 OP_PUSHBYTES_20 512d8dd8d595cdb3bf0008cb47e0753118be6e11
address
tb1q2ykcmkx4jhxm80cqpr950cr4xyvtums36zyre5
transaction
1bad6d393cbe45b462dc51f00223e69734218ebd275a7e86fcc0c7cc795b5bfa
confirmations
105032
spent
false

1 Sat Range